发布网友 发布时间:2022-05-24 15:45
共1个回答
热心网友 时间:2023-10-19 08:21
你是用递归方式,你判断 files.isDirectory 当前是文件包时又继续调用了自己,但是调用完自己后始终要出来继续走之前的判断,所以如果当前是文件包,你会判断,进入文件包,便利文件包里内容,如有文件包继续,如没有,跳出来,继续上个文件路径的判断公式里继续走逻辑,而上个判断逻辑里files是文件包,你又要求打印出来,恩,所以文件包也被你打出来了.说的复杂了点点- -...咳咳..